计算机创意编程是什么意思

worktile 其他 2

回复

共3条回复 我来回复
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    计算机创意编程是一种将计算机科学与创意艺术相结合的编程方式。它不仅注重计算机程序的逻辑和功能,还追求通过计算机程序表达创意和艺术的特点。通过计算机创意编程,程序员可以利用编程语言和工具来创造出独特的艺术作品、交互式媒体和视觉效果等。这种编程方式不仅限于传统的软件开发,而是更加注重创新和个性化的表达方式。

    计算机创意编程的核心思想是将计算机程序作为艺术的创作工具。通过编写代码,程序员可以实现各种创意和艺术效果,如生成艺术图像、音乐、动画和交互式应用等。创意编程强调的是以计算机程序为媒介,通过算法和代码来创造出具有艺术性和创新性的作品。

    在计算机创意编程中,常用的编程语言包括Processing、OpenFrameworks、Cinder等。这些编程语言提供了丰富的图形和音频库,可以方便地实现创意编程的目标。此外,还有一些专门针对艺术和创意领域开发的编程工具和框架,如Pure Data、Max/MSP等。

    计算机创意编程的应用范围非常广泛。它可以应用于艺术创作、设计、教育和娱乐等领域。通过计算机创意编程,艺术家可以利用计算机技术来创造出独特的艺术作品。设计师可以利用创意编程来实现创新的设计理念和交互体验。教育领域可以借助创意编程来培养学生的创造力和计算思维能力。娱乐领域可以通过创意编程来开发各种创新的游戏和娱乐应用。

    总之,计算机创意编程是一种将计算机科学和创意艺术相结合的编程方式,通过编写代码实现创意和艺术效果。它具有广泛的应用领域,可以为艺术创作、设计、教育和娱乐等领域带来新的可能性。

    1年前 0条评论
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    计算机创意编程是指使用计算机编程技术来创造、表达和展现艺术、设计和创意思维的过程。它结合了计算机科学和艺术创作的元素,旨在通过编程语言和工具创造出独特的艺术作品、互动体验或创新的设计。

    以下是计算机创意编程的几个重要方面:

    1. 编程语言和工具:计算机创意编程使用各种编程语言和工具,如Processing、OpenFrameworks、Max/MSP、Pure Data等。这些语言和工具提供了一系列函数、库和工具包,使创作者能够使用代码来创建艺术作品和互动体验。

    2. 可视化艺术和设计:计算机创意编程可以用于创建各种形式的可视化艺术和设计作品。通过编程,创作者可以探索图形、动画、音频和视频等媒体的创作方式,创造出独特的视觉效果和交互体验。

    3. 互动艺术和装置:计算机创意编程可以用于创作互动艺术和装置,使观众能够与作品进行实时的互动和参与。通过编程,可以实现各种传感器和控制器的连接,从而创造出能够感知观众动作和环境变化的艺术作品。

    4. 数据可视化和信息设计:计算机创意编程可以用于将复杂的数据和信息可视化,使其更易于理解和呈现。通过编程,可以将数据转化为图表、图形和动画等形式,以便观众更好地理解和分析数据。

    5. 教育和社区参与:计算机创意编程也被广泛应用于教育领域,用于培养学生的创造力、解决问题的能力和计算思维。此外,计算机创意编程也促进了创作者和编程社区之间的交流和合作,让更多人参与到创意编程的实践中。

    总而言之,计算机创意编程是一种融合了计算机科学和艺术创作的领域,通过编程语言和工具创造出独特的艺术作品、互动体验和创新的设计。它在可视化艺术、互动艺术、数据可视化和教育等领域有着广泛的应用和影响。

    1年前 0条评论
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    计算机创意编程是指利用计算机科学与艺术相结合的方法,通过编程创造出具有创意性和艺术性的作品。它涵盖了计算机图形学、计算机音乐、计算机动画、计算机游戏设计等多个领域,旨在将计算机技术与艺术创作相结合,创造出独特的、具有艺术性的作品。

    计算机创意编程可以通过编写代码来实现,利用编程语言和开发工具,开发者可以实现各种创意性的想法。创意编程的核心思想是将计算机编程作为一种创作媒介,通过编写代码来实现艺术作品或者创新的交互体验。

    在计算机创意编程中,可以使用多种编程语言,如Processing、Max/MSP、OpenFrameworks、Cinder等。这些编程语言都提供了丰富的图形、音频、视频等库,使得开发者可以通过编写代码来实现各种创意性的作品。

    在实际操作中,计算机创意编程可以分为以下几个步骤:

    1. 设计创意:首先需要明确创意的目标和想要表达的内容。可以通过手绘草图、写作或者其他形式来设计创意的概念和构思。

    2. 选择编程语言和工具:根据创意的需求,选择合适的编程语言和开发工具。不同的编程语言和工具有不同的特点和功能,可以根据具体需求进行选择。

    3. 学习编程知识:如果没有编程经验,需要学习相关的编程知识和技巧。可以通过在线教程、编程书籍、视频教程等方式学习编程基础知识。

    4. 编写代码:根据设计好的创意,开始编写代码来实现。可以使用编程语言提供的库和函数,实现图形、音频、视频等效果。

    5. 调试和优化:在编写代码的过程中,可能会出现错误和问题。需要进行调试和优化,确保作品的正常运行和良好的用户体验。

    6. 展示和分享:完成作品后,可以通过展示和分享的方式来展示自己的创意编程作品。可以通过个人网站、社交媒体、展览等方式与他人分享自己的作品。

    总结起来,计算机创意编程是一种将计算机科学和艺术创作相结合的创新方式,通过编写代码来实现创意性和艺术性的作品。它涉及到多个领域,需要掌握相关的编程知识和技巧,以及艺术创作的基本原理。通过计算机创意编程,可以创造出独特的、具有艺术性的作品,拓展了艺术创作的可能性。

    1年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部